Program Overview :

This program is designed to educate learners to be able to understand the main ideas of complex text on both concrete and abstract topics, including technical discussions in his/her field of specialization. Learners will be able to interact with a degree of fluency and spontaneity that makes regular interaction with native speakers quite possible without strain for either party. They will be also able to produce clear, detailed text on a wide range of subject and explain a viewpoint on a topical issue giving the advantages and disadvantages of various options. Upon successful completion, learners should be able to achieve CLB level 8 and IELTS 6.5.

Admission Requirements:
  • Applicants must provide proof of meeting English language competency requirements. (Please refer to the language proficiency policy.)
Language Competency Requirement

(Evidence of one of the following test scores)

  • International English Language Testing System (IELTS): Academic or General -- test must be within the last two years: Overall score of 6.0
  • The Test of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L): test must be within the last two years, IBT only -- Overall score of 78
  • Canadian English Language Proficiency Index Program (CELPIP - General): test within the last two years, Listening 7, Speaking 7, Reading 7 and Writing 7
  • Canadian Language Benchmark Placement Test (CLB PT): test must be within the last year: Listening 7, Speaking 7, Reading 7 and Writing 7 (Note: a CLB Report Card from a LINC Program may also be accepted.)
  • Canadian English Language Benchmark Assessment for Nurses (CELBAN): test within the last two years, Listening 7, Speaking 7, Reading 7, and Writing 7
  • Gateway College ESL Placement Test Level 7
  • ‘Integrated Skills English Language – Upper-Intermediate’ course (Gateway College): 60% or above
